Together with the project partners German Red Cross (DRK), Workers' Samaritan Federation (ASB), German Life Saving Association (DLRG), Johanniter-Unfall-Hilfe (JUH) and Malteser (MHD), the Federal Office of Civil Protection and Disaster Assistance (BBK) presents the pilot project “Shelter Lab 5000” and the associated "federal emergency shelter capacity".
The federal emergency shelter capacity, which is currently being set up, is to comprise up to ten "mobile shelter and support modules". With the materials of such a module, up to 5000 people at a time can be accommodated and cared for at short notice, simultaneously and largely self-sufficiently for a period of up to one year. At our exhibition stand, visitors can find out about the project, the tests carried out so far and their results; examples of the material and equipment procured will also be on display. In addition there will be a lecture area where the shelter module and the initial deployment experiences will be presented.
